What he said could've been taken very out of context, you see the X-Box and PS2 can generate Toy Story like graphics, just not real time. Partial quotes like that are pointless, while I agree with you that the PS3 so far looks to be capable of delivering better graphics than the XB360 I need to point out that Sony has lied before, hell pretty much every profit making company lies or twists the truth regularly to wow people or confuse them basically to make people think what they want you to think.

Back onto the thread topic it'self, games can't be compared to demos designed to specifically showcase one of the consoles abilities, early game demo's however can be like GT2000 and GT3 and then GT4. It makes sence to say later games will look better, how soon that will happen I don't know, but tbh I'd rather the developers concentrate on making more immersive experiences, making games allow you to do more, improving the AI to more believable levels ect.
 
The cell is a 9 core processor,with one core acting as the brain. The other 8 cores are high perfomance vector processors. Each of the 8 cores is capable of 32 gigaflops each. I have no doubt it will surpass the tech demos, unless sony is lieing.
 
^^^ It's not "9 cores". It's 1 core and 8 SPE's. Each SPE works as a processing unit, but it not considered a "core".
